Chester Playhouse Society is a charitable organization based in Chester, Nova Scotia, classified by the CRA under arts. In its fiscal year ending December 31, 2024, it reported $897K in revenue and $909K in expenditures.

Its funding that year was roughly 30% from donations, 15% from government, 6% from other charities. In 2024, 7 other registered charities reported granting it a combined $99K.

Compared with 724 arts charities of similar size, its share of spending on mission — charitable programs plus grants to other charities — ranked above 43% of peers. Its highest-paid positions fell in the $40,000–79,999 range (2 positions in that band). The charity reported 6 permanent full-time positions.

Its filed list of directors and trustees shows 14 names.

In its own words

The chester playhouse society operates the chester playhouse as a venue that makes world-class performing arts events accessible to a broad rural community in the municipality of the district of chester. They support community outreach by partnering with local groups including the chester drama society. The playhouse also runs theater programs for youth through the summer and fall months and sponsor other community groups in various way to support benefits and fundraisers

Ongoing-program description from its T3010 filing, verbatim.
